Antarkranti, an initiative of DJJS working for reformation and rehabilitation of prisoners, organized a special program in Central Jail Gwalior on the occasion of Ganesh Chaturthi. The program conducted on September 20, 2015 had the presence of 2500 inmates.

Ganesh Chaturthi Celebrated in Central Jail  Gwalior, Madhya Pradesh

The program started with beautiful bhajans in the glory of almighty, which created a positive and serene atmosphere in and around. The orchestra team of the Jail also participated by delivering a beautiful musical performance.

The symbolic meaning and significance of the festival of Ganesh Chaturthi was highlighted by the DJJS preachers. The truth behind the unusual appearance of Lord Ganesha was disclosed. Knowledge and Wisdom, message carried by Lord Ganesh was brought to the focus of the attendees.

The program concluded with ‘Pooja’ and ‘Aarti’ of Lord Ganesha, and ‘Prasad’ was distributed to the prisoners.
